Understanding the Basics

Before you head to Walmart, it’s essential to understand what a fishing license entails. A fishing license is a regulatory or legal mechanism to control fishing activities. It ensures that fish populations are managed sustainably, and it helps fund conservation efforts. The requirements for obtaining a license can vary significantly depending on your location, the type of fishing you plan to do, and your residency status.

Step-by-Step Guide to Getting a Fishing License at Walmart

1. Check Your State’s Requirements

  • Residency Status: Most states offer different licenses for residents and non-residents. Ensure you know which category you fall into.
  • Age Requirements: Some states require licenses for all ages, while others have age exemptions, typically for children under a certain age.
  • Type of Fishing: Different licenses may be required for freshwater, saltwater, or specific types of fish.

2. Gather Necessary Documentation

  • Identification: A valid government-issued ID is usually required.
  • Proof of Residency: If you’re applying for a resident license, you may need to provide proof of residency, such as a utility bill or driver’s license.
  • Social Security Number: Some states require this for identification purposes.

3. Visit Your Local Walmart

  • Locate the Sporting Goods Section: Fishing licenses are typically issued in the sporting goods department.
  • Speak to a Representative: A Walmart associate will guide you through the process, which usually involves filling out a form and paying the required fee.

4. Complete the Application

  • Fill Out the Form: Provide all necessary information accurately.
  • Pay the Fee: Fees vary by state and type of license. Payment can usually be made via cash, credit card, or debit card.

5. Receive Your License

  • Instant Issuance: In most cases, you’ll receive your license immediately after completing the application and payment.
  • Digital or Physical Copy: Some states offer digital licenses that can be stored on your smartphone, while others provide a physical copy.

Additional Tips

  • Check for Discounts: Some states offer discounts for seniors, military personnel, or disabled individuals.
  • Renewal Reminders: Set a reminder for when your license is due for renewal to avoid any lapses.
  • Know the Regulations: Familiarize yourself with local fishing regulations, including catch limits and restricted areas.

FAQs

Q: Can I get a fishing license at any Walmart?

A: Most Walmart stores offer fishing licenses, but it’s always a good idea to call ahead and confirm with your local store.

Q: How much does a fishing license cost at Walmart?

A: The cost varies by state and type of license. Resident licenses are generally cheaper than non-resident licenses.

Q: Do I need a fishing license if I’m fishing on private property?

A: It depends on the state. Some states require a license regardless of where you’re fishing, while others may have exemptions for private property.

Q: Can I buy a fishing license online instead of going to Walmart?

A: Yes, many states offer online purchasing options through their Department of Natural Resources or equivalent agency websites.

Q: What happens if I fish without a license?

A: Fishing without a license can result in fines, confiscation of equipment, and other penalties. It’s always best to obtain the proper license before fishing.
